Americana Highways brings you this premiere of The Deltaz’ song “I Went Away Too Much,” from their forthcoming album Turn It Back. The album was recorded and engineered by The Deltaz and mastered by Tommy Wiggins.

“I Went Away Too Much” is Ted Siegel on guitar and vocals;  John Siegel on drums, harmonica, percussion and backing vocals;  Corey Dawson on bass; and Bobby Victor on Wurlitzer electric keyboard.  The idea that one partner went away too much is surely a common stressor.  The poppy harmonies of the Deltaz belie the song’s addressing a more serious complication when dealing with others in life.  The Deltaz  do a great job of crafting a memorable tune with a seriously catchy refrain.

“I Went Away Too Much”  is one of those break up songs you always want to write. As a songwriter its your duty to not waste an opportunity like a relationship gone bad, especially if it’s got a good story. We’ve traveled around the world performing and its an experience that I would never trade but it ends up putting too much space between you and the people back home. I feel like my favorite heartbreak tunes get you dancing so we threw in a Tom Petty guitar driven backbeat and a harmonica solo. — The Deltaz
